This is an automated email from the ASF dual-hosted git repository.
siyao p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/hadoop-ozone.git.
from c5b0ba6 HDDS-3812. Disable netty resource leak detector in datanode.
(#1080)
add 20bb5b5 HDDS-2840. Implement ofs://: mkdir (#415)
add 79c0c1c HDDS-2665. Merge master to HDDS-2665-ofs branch (#511)
add 3d39723 Revert "HDDS-2665. Merge master to HDDS-2665-ofs branch
(#511)"
add ec9986b Merge branch 'master' into HDDS-2665
add 87288a2 HDDS-2665. Addendum fix for merge master due to HDDS-2188
revert. Contributed by Siyao Meng.
add 3e4782d HDDS-2979. Implement ofs://: Fix getFileStatus for mkdir
volume (#528)
add 7c35d76 HDDS-2928. Implement ofs://: listStatus (#547)
add 0610ce3 HDDS-3073. Implement ofs://: Fix listStatus continuation
(#606)
add c410c4d HDDS-2929. Implement ofs://: temp directory mount (#610)
add 5616dc3 HDDS-2945. Implement ofs://: Add robot tests for mkdir. (#703)
add 3c5ec6a Merge branch 'master' into HDDS-2665-ofs
add 3eaec50 HDDS-3279. Rebase OFS branch (#731)
add 8356a4a HDDS-3390. Adapt OFSPath to master branch changes (#847)
add dd99223 Merge remote-tracking branch 'asf/master' into HDDS-2665-ofs
add 9ed2e15 HDDS-3390. Rebase OFS branch - 2. Adapt OFS classes to
HDDS-3101 (#822)
add 0773a4a HDDS-3494. Implement ofs://: Support volume and bucket
deletion (#906)
add 28540cb HDDS-3574. Implement ofs://: Override getTrashRoot (#941)
add d6d31c6 HDDS-2969. Implement ofs://: Add contract test (#865)
add a00dc18 Merge remote-tracking branch 'asf/master' into HDDS-2665-ofs
add b9dac41 HDDS-3709. Rebase OFS branch - 3. Adapt to HDDS-3501 (#1015)
add f229222 Merge remote-tracking branch 'origin/master' into
HDDS-2665-ofs
add f64315f HDDS-3767. [OFS] Address merge conflicts after HDDS-3627
add 2eb3181 Merge remote-tracking branch 'origin/master' into
HDDS-2665-ofs
new 75de083 Merge branch 'HDDS-2665-ofs'
The 1 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ails. The revisions
listed as "add" were already present in the repository and have only
been added to this reference.
Summary of changes:
.../java/org/apache/hadoop/ozone/OzoneConsts.java | 1 +
.../dist/src/main/compose/ozone/docker-config | 2 +
.../src/main/compose/ozonesecure/docker-config | 1 +
.../dist/src/main/smoketest/ozonefs/ozonefs.robot | 119 +--
.../hadoop/fs/ozone/TestRootedOzoneFileSystem.java | 874 ++++++++++++++++++++
.../ITestRootedOzoneContractCreate.java} | 12 +-
.../ITestRootedOzoneContractDelete.java} | 12 +-
.../ITestRootedOzoneContractDistCp.java} | 14 +-
.../ITestRootedOzoneContractGetFileStatus.java} | 23 +-
.../ITestRootedOzoneContractMkdir.java} | 12 +-
.../ITestRootedOzoneContractOpen.java} | 12 +-
.../ITestRootedOzoneContractRename.java} | 12 +-
.../ITestRootedOzoneContractRootDir.java} | 22 +-
.../ITestRootedOzoneContractSeek.java} | 12 +-
.../RootedOzoneContract.java} | 32 +-
.../hadoop/ozone/shell/TestOzoneShellHA.java | 89 ++
.../fs/ozone/BasicOzoneClientAdapterImpl.java | 5 +
.../hadoop/fs/ozone/BasicOzoneFileSystem.java | 7 +
.../ozone/BasicRootedOzoneClientAdapterImpl.java | 899 +++++++++++++++++++++
...System.java => BasicRootedOzoneFileSystem.java} | 320 +++++---
.../java/org/apache/hadoop/fs/ozone/OFSPath.java | 311 +++++++
.../apache/hadoop/fs/ozone/OzoneClientAdapter.java | 3 +
...Impl.java => RootedOzoneClientAdapterImpl.java} | 22 +-
.../org/apache/hadoop/fs/ozone/TestOFSPath.java | 154 ++++
...eFileSystem.java => RootedOzoneFileSystem.java} | 4 +-
.../hadoop/fs/ozone/RootedOzoneFileSystem.java} | 32 +-
...eFileSystem.java => RootedOzoneFileSystem.java} | 32 +-
27 files changed, 2732 insertions(+), 306 deletions(-)
create mode 100644
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/TestRootedOzoneFileSystem.java
copy
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/contract/{ITestOzoneContractCreate.java
=> rooted/ITestRootedOzoneContractCreate.java} (81%)
copy
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/contract/{ITestOzoneContractDelete.java
=> rooted/ITestRootedOzoneContractDelete.java} (81%)
copy
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/contract/{ITestOzoneContractDistCp.java
=> rooted/ITestRootedOzoneContractDistCp.java} (78%)
copy
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/contract/{ITestOzoneContractGetFileStatus.java
=> rooted/ITestRootedOzoneContractGetFileStatus.java} (72%)
copy
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/contract/{ITestOzoneContractMkdir.java
=> rooted/ITestRootedOzoneContractMkdir.java} (81%)
copy
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/contract/{ITestOzoneContractOpen.java
=> rooted/ITestRootedOzoneContractOpen.java} (81%)
copy
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/contract/{ITestOzoneContractRename.java
=> rooted/ITestRootedOzoneContractRename.java} (81%)
copy
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/contract/{ITestOzoneContractRootDir.java
=> rooted/ITestRootedOzoneContractRootDir.java} (72%)
copy
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/contract/{ITestOzoneContractSeek.java
=> rooted/ITestRootedOzoneContractSeek.java} (81%)
copy
hadoop-ozone/integration-test/src/test/java/org/apache/hadoop/fs/ozone/contract/{OzoneContract.java
=> rooted/RootedOzoneContract.java} (82%)
create mode 100644
hadoop-ozone/ozonefs-common/src/main/java/org/apache/hadoop/fs/ozone/BasicRootedOzoneClientAdapterImpl.java
copy
hadoop-ozone/ozonefs-common/src/main/java/org/apache/hadoop/fs/ozone/{BasicOzoneFileSystem.java
=> BasicRootedOzoneFileSystem.java} (71%)
create mode 100644
hadoop-ozone/ozonefs-common/src/main/java/org/apache/hadoop/fs/ozone/OFSPath.java
copy
hadoop-ozone/ozonefs-common/src/main/java/org/apache/hadoop/fs/ozone/{OzoneClientAdapterImpl.java
=> RootedOzoneClientAdapterImpl.java} (72%)
create mode 100644
hadoop-ozone/ozonefs-common/src/test/java/org/apache/hadoop/fs/ozone/TestOFSPath.java
copy
hadoop-ozone/ozonefs-hadoop2/src/main/java/org/apache/hadoop/fs/ozone/{OzoneFileSystem.java
=> RootedOzoneFileSystem.java} (86%)
copy
hadoop-ozone/{ozonefs/src/main/java/org/apache/hadoop/fs/ozone/OzoneFileSystem.java
=>
ozonefs-hadoop3/src/main/java/org/apache/hadoop/fs/ozone/RootedOzoneFileSystem.java}
(83%)
copy
hadoop-ozone/ozonefs/src/main/java/org/apache/hadoop/fs/ozone/{OzoneFileSystem.java
=> RootedOzoneFileSystem.java} (83%)
---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]